emPhAsIs on hAzArds
The.emphasis.in.this.chapter.is.on.safety.hazards..Hazards.are.defined.as.a.source.
of.danger.that.could.result.in.a.chance.event.such.as.an.accident..A.danger.itself.is.a.
potential.exposure.or.a.liability.to.injury,.pain,.or.loss..Not.all.hazards.and.dangers.
are.the.same..Exposure.to.hazards.may.be.dangerous.but.this.depends.on.the.amount.
of.risk.that.accompanies.it..The.risk.of.water.contained.by.a.dam.is.different.from.
being.caught.in.a.small.boat.in.rapidly.flowing.water..Risk.is.the.possibility.of.loss.or.
injury.or.the.degree.of.the.possibility.of.such.loss..Accidents.do.not.occur.if.a.hazard.
does.not.exist.that.presents.a.danger.to.those.working.around.it..If.the.potential.expo-sure.is.high,.there.is.a.greater.risk.that.an.undesired.event.will.occur..An.accident.
is.an.unplanned.or.undesirable.event.whose.outcome.is.normally.a.trauma..Trauma.
is.the.injury.to.living.tissue.caused.by.some.outside.or.extrinsic.agent..Trauma.is.
caused.by.an.agent,.force,.or.mechanism.impinging.on.the.human.body.
The.emphasis.area.regarding.safety.hazards.will.be.to.identify.the.hazard.and.its.
danger,.and.to.suggest.ways.to.remove,.intervene,.or.mitigate.its.risk.for.the.purpose.
of.preventing.accidents.that.result.from.the.errant.uncontrolled.release.of.energy.that.
normally.results.in.trauma.to.those.who.have.the.exposure.to.that.hazard.
AccIdent cAuses
Experts.who.study.accidents.often.do.a.“breakdown”.or.analysis.of.the.causes..They.
analyze.them.at.three.different.levels:
. 1..Direct.causes.(unplanned.release.of.energy.and/or.hazardous.material) . 2..Indirect.causes.(unsafe.acts.and.unsafe.conditions)
. 3..Basic.causes.(management.safety.policies.and.decisions,.and.personal.factors)
DirECt CAusEs
Most.accidents.are.caused.by.the.unplanned.or.unwanted.release.of.large.amounts.of.
energy,.or.of.hazardous.materials..In.a.breakdown.of.accident.causes,.the.direct.cause.
is.the.energy.or.hazardous.material.released.at.the.time.of.the.accident..Accident.
investigators. are. interested. in. finding. out. what. the. direct. cause. of. an. accident. is.
because.this.information.can.be.used.to.help.prevent.other.accidents,.or.to.reduce.the.
injuries.associated.with.them.

Energy.is.classified.in.one.of.two.ways:.it.is.either.potential.or.kinetic.energy..
Potential energy.is.defined.as.stored.energy,.such.as.a.rock.on.the.top.of.a.hill..There.
are. usually. two. components. to. potential. energy:. the. weight. of. the. object. and. its.
height..The.rock.resting.at.the.bottom.of.the.hill.has.little.potential.energy.as.com-pared.to.the.one.at.the.top.of.the.hill.
The.other.classification.is.kinetic.energy,.which.is.best.described.as.energy.motion..
Kinetic energy. depends. on. the. mass. of. the. object.. Mass. is. the. amount. of. matter.
.making.up.an.object,.such.as.an.elephant.has.more.matter.than.a.mouse,.and.therefore.
more.mass..The.weight.of.an.object.is.a.factor.of.the.mass.of.an.object.and.the.pull.of.
gravity.on.that.object..Kinetic.energy.is.a.function.of.an.object’s.mass.and.its.speed.of.
movement.(or.velocity)..A.bullet.thrown.at.you.has.the.same.mass.as.one.shot.at.you,.
but.the.difference.is.in.the.velocity.and.there.is.not.any.disagreement.as.to.which.has.
the.most.kinetic.energy.or.potential.to.cause.the.greatest.damage.or.harm.
Energy.comes.in.many.forms,.and.each.has.its.own.unique.potential.for.release.of.
energy.and.the.ensuing.form.of.danger.and.potential.for.an.accident.and.the.trauma.that.
it.can.cause..The.forms.of.energy.are.pressure,.biological,.chemical,.electrical,.thermal,.
light,.mechanical,.and.nuclear..Examples.of.each.form.of.energy.are.found.in.Table 4.2.
If.the.direct.cause.is.known,.then.equipment,.materials,.and.facilities.can.be.rede-signed.to.make.them.safer;.personal.protection.can.be.provided.to.reduce.injuries;.and.
workers.can.be.trained.to.be.aware.of.hazardous.situations.so.that.they.can.protect.
themselves.against.them..The.remainder.of.this.book.is.directed.toward.managing,.
preventing,.and.controlling.hazards.that.occur.within.the.nation’s.industries.
hAzArd AnAlysIs
Hazard.analysis.is.a.technique.used.to.examine.the.workplace.for.hazards.with.the.
potential.to.cause.accidents..Hazard.identification,.as.envisioned.in.this.section,.is.a.
worker-oriented.process..The.workers.are.trained.in.hazard.identification.and.asked.
to.recognize.and.report.hazards.for.evaluation.and.assessment..Management.is.not.
as.close.to.the.actual.work.being.performed.as.are.those.performing.the.work..Even.
supervisors.can.use.extra.pairs.of.eyes.looking.for.areas.of.concern.
Workers.may.already.have.hazard.concerns.and.have.often.devised.ways.to.miti-gate.the.hazards,.thus.preventing.injuries.and.accidents..This.type.of.information.is.
invaluable.when.removing.and.reducing.workplace.hazards.
This. approach. to. hazard. identification. does. not. require. that. someone. with. spe-cial.training.conduct.it..It.can.usually.be.accomplished.using.a.short.fill-in-the-blank.
questionnaire..This.hazard.identification.technique.works.well.where.management.is.
open.and.genuinely.concerned.about.the.safety.and.health.of.its.workforce..The.most.
time-consuming. portion. of. this. process. is. analyzing. the. assessment. and. response.
regarding.potential.hazards.identified..Empowering.workers.to.identify.hazards,.make.
recommendations.on.abatement.of.the.hazards,.and.then.suggest.how.management.
can.respond.to.these.potential.hazards.is.essential..Only.three.responses.are.required:
. 1..Identify.the.hazard(s).
. 2..Explain.how.the.hazard(s).could.be.abated.
. 3..Suggest.what.the.company.could.do..Use.a.form.similar.to.the.one.found.in.
Table 4.3.

The. information. obtained. from. the. hazard. identification. process. provides. the.
foundation.for.making.decisions.upon.which.jobs.should.be.altered.in.order.for.the.
worker.to.perform.the.work.safer.and.expeditiously..Also,.this.process.allows.work-ers.to.become.more.involved.in.their.own.destiny..For.some.time,.involvement.has.
been.recognized.as.a.key.motivator.of.people..This.is.also.a.positive.mechanism.for.
fostering.labor/management.cooperation.
It.is.important.to.remember.that.a.worker.may.perceive.something.as.a.hazard,.
when.in.fact.it.may.not.be.a.true.one;.the.risk.may.not.match.the.ranking.that.the.
worker. places. on. it.. Also,. even. if. hazards. do. exist,. you. need. to. prioritize. them..
Companies.need.to.prioritize.them.according.to.the.ones.that.can.be.handled.quickly,.
the.ones.that.may.take.time,.or.those.that.will.cost.money.above.their.budget..If.the.
correction.will.cause.a.large.capital.expense.and.the.risk.is.real.but.does.not.exhibit.
an.extreme.danger.to.life.and.health,.companies.might.need.to.wait.until.next.year’s.
budget.cycle..An.example.of.this.would.be.when.workers.complain.of.a.smell.and.
dust.created.by.a.chemical.process..If.the.dust.is.not.above.accepted.exposure.limits.
and.the.smell.is.not.overwhelming,.then.the.company.may.elect.to.install.a.new.ven-tilation.system—but.not.until.the.next.year.because.of.budgetary.constraints..The.
use.of.PPE.until.the.hazard.can.be.removed.would.be.required.
Hazard.identification.is.a.process.controlled.by.management..Management.must.
assess.the.outcome.of.the.hazard.identification.process.and.determine.if.immediate.
action.is.necessary.or.if,.in.fact,.there.is.an.actual.hazard.involved..When.the.company.
does.not.view.a.reported.hazard.as.an.actual.hazard,.it.is.critical.to.the.ongoing.process.
to.inform.the.workers.that.the.company.does.not.view.it.as.a.true.hazard.and.explain.
why..This.will.ensure.the.continued.cooperation.of.workers.in.hazard.identification.
The. expected. benefits. are. a. decrease. in. the. incidence. of. injuries,. a. decrease.
in. lost. workdays. and. absenteeism,. a. decrease. in. workers’. compensation. costs,.
increased.productivity,.and.better.cooperation.and.communication..The.baseline.for.
determining. the. benefit. of. hazard. identification. can. be. formulated. from. existing.

WorksIte hAzArd AnAlysIs
Worksite.analysis.is.the.process.of.identifying.hazards.related.to.a.project,.process,.
or. activities. at. the. worksite.. Identify. hazards. before. determining. how. to. protect.
employees.. In. performing. worksite. analyses,. consider. not. only. hazards. that. cur-rently.exist,.but.also.hazards.that.could.occur.because.of.changes.in.operations.or.
procedures. or. because. of. other. factors,. such. as. concurrent. work. activities.. First,.
perform.hazard.analyses.of.all.activities.and.projects.prior.to.the.start.of.work,.deter-mine.the.hazards.involved.with.each.phase.of.the.project,.and.perform.regular.safety.
and.health.site.inspections..Second,.require.supervisors.and.employees.to.inspect.
their.work.areas.prior.to.the.start.of.each.shift.or.new.activity,.investigate.accidents.
and.near-misses,.and.analyze.trends.in.accident.and.injury.data.
When.performing.a.worksite.analysis,.all.hazards.should.be.identified..This.means.
conducting.comprehensive.baseline.worksite.surveys.for.safety.and.health.and.periodic.
comprehensive.updated.surveys..Companies.must.analyze.planned.and.new.facilities,.
processes,.materials,.and.equipment,.as.well.as.perform.routine.job.hazard.analyses..
This.also.means.that.regular.site.safety.and.health.inspections.should.be.conducted.so.
that.new.or.previously.missed.hazards.and.failures.in.hazard.controls.are.identified.
A.hazard.reporting/response.program.should.be.developed.to.utilize.employees’.
insight.and.experience.in.safety.and.health.protection..Employees’.concerns.should.
be.addressed,.and.a.reliable.system.should.be.provided.whereby.employees,.with-out.fear.of.reprisal,.can.notify.management.personnel.about.conditions.that.appear.
hazardous..These.notifications.should.receive.timely.and.appropriate.responses,.and.
employees.should.be.encouraged.to.use.this.system.
Another.way.to.maintain.a.worksite.hazard.analysis.is.to.investigate.accidents.
and. near-miss. incidents. so. that. their. causes,. and. means. for. their. prevention,. are.
identified..By.analyzing.injury.and.illness.trends.over.a.period.of.time,.patterns.with.
common.causes.can.be.identified.and.prevented.
Each.company.may.require.different.types.of.hazard.analyses,.depending.on.the.
company’s.role,.the.size.and.complexity.of.the.worksite,.and.the.nature.of.associated.
hazards..The.company.may.choose.to.use.a.project.hazard.analysis,.a.phase.hazard.
analysis,.or.job.safety.assessment.
A.project.hazard.analysis.(preliminary.hazard.analysis).should.be.performed.for.
each.project.prior.to.the.start.of.work.and.should.provide.a.basis.for.the.project-specific.
safety.and.health.plan..The.project.hazard.analysis.should.identify.the.following:
. 1..The.anticipated.phases.of.the.project
. 2..The.types.of.hazards.likely.associated.with.each.anticipated.phase
. 3.. The. control. measures. necessary. to. protect. site. workers. from. the. identified.
hazards
. 4..Those.phases.and.specific.operations.of.the.project.for.which.activities.or.
related. protective. measures. must. be. designed,. supervised,. approved,. or.
inspected.by.a.registered.professional.engineer.or.competent.person
. 5..Phases. and. specific. operations. of. the. project. that. will. require. further.
analyses.are.those.that.have.a.complexity.of.potential.hazards.or.unusual.
activities.involved;.those.where.there.may.be.uncertainty.concerning.the.
worksite’s.condition.at.the.time.of.project;.or.those.where.there.is.concern.
for.methods.that.will.be.used.to.complete.a.phase.or.operation
A.phase.hazard.analysis.may.be.performed.for.those.phases.of.the.project.for.
which.the.project.hazard.analysis.has.identified.the.need.for.further.analysis,.and.for.
those.phases.of.the.project.for.which.methods.or.site.conditions.have.changed.since.
the.project.hazard.analysis.was.completed..The.phase.hazard.analysis.is.performed.
prior. to. the. start. of. work. on. that. phase. of. the. project. and. is. expanded,. based. on.
the.results.of.the.project.hazard.analysis,.to.provide.a.more.thorough.evaluation.of.
related.work.activities.and.site.conditions..As.appropriate,.the.phase.hazard.analysis.
should.include
. 1..Identification.of.the.specific.work.operations.or.procedures
. 2..An.evaluation.of.the.hazards.associated.with.the.specific.chemicals,.equip-ment,.materials,.and.procedures.used.or.present.during.the.performance.of.
that.phase.of.work
. 3..An.evaluation.of.how.safety.and.health.has.impacted.any.changes.in.the.
schedule;.and.how.work.procedures.or.site.conditions.that.have.occurred.
since.performance.of.the.project.hazard.analysis.need.to.be.completed . 4..Identification. of. specific. control. measures. necessary. to. protect. workers.
from.the.identified.hazards
. 5..Identification.of.specific.operations.for.which.protective.measures.or.proce-dures.must.be.designed,.supervised,.approved,.or.inspected.by.a.registered.
professional.engineer.or.competent.person
A.job.safety.assessment.or.analysis.should.be.performed.at.the.start.of.any.task.
or. operation.. The. designated. competent. or. authorized. person. should. evaluate. the.
task.or.operation.to.identify.potential.hazards.and.determine.the.necessary.controls..
This.assessment.should.focus.on.actual.worksite.conditions.or.procedures.that.differ.
from.or.were.not.anticipated.in.the.related.project.or.phase.hazard.analysis..In.addi-tion,.the.authorized.person.should.ensure.that.each.employee.involved.in.the.task.or.
operation.is.aware.of.the.hazards.related.to.the.task.or.operation.and.of.the.measures.
or.procedures.that.workers.and.visitors.must.use.to.protect.themselves..Note:.The.job.
safety.assessment.is.not.intended.to.be.a.formal,.documented.analysis,.but.instead.is.
more.of.a.quick.check.of.actual.site.conditions.and.a.review.of.planned.procedures.
and.precautions..A.more.detailed.explanation.of.job.safety.analysis.is.provided.in.
Chapter.12.
trAInIng on hAzArd IdentIFIcAtIon
Supervisors.and.workers.must.be.trained.to.both.identify.hazards.in.order.to.pre-vent.accidents,.and.to.identify.existing.and.potential.hazards.that.may.prevail.in.the.
workplace..When.looking.at.specific.jobs,.identify.the.hazards.by.breaking.down.the.
job.into.a.step-by-step.sequence.and.identifying.potential.hazards.associated.with.
each.step..Consider.the.following:
. 1..Is.there.a.danger.of.striking.against,. being. struck. by,.or.otherwise.mak-ing.injurious.contact.with.an.object?.(Example:.Can.tools.or.materials.be.
dropped.from.overhead,.striking.workers.below?)
. 2..Can. the. employee. be. caught. in,. on,. or. between. objects?. (Example:. an.
unguarded.V-belt,.gears,.or.reciprocating.machinery.)
. 3..Can.the.employee.slip,.trip,.or.fall.on.the.same.level,.or.to.another.level?.
(Example:.slipping.in.an.oil-changing.area.of.a.garage,.tripping.on.material.
left.on.stairways,.or.falling.from.a.scaffold.)
. 4..Can. the. employee. strain. him-. or. herself. by. pushing,. pulling,. or. lifting?.
(Example:.pushing.a.load.into.place.or.pulling.a.load.on.a.hand.truck.) . 5..Does.the.environment.have.hazardous.toxic.gas,.vapors,.mist,.fumes,.dust,.
heat,.or.ionizing.or.nonionizing.radiation?.(Example:.Arc.welding.on.gal-vanized.sheet.metal.produces.toxic.fumes.and.nonionizing.radiation.) During.training,.practice.identifying.all.hazards.or.potential.hazards..With.iden- tification.of.the.hazards,.take.steps.to.prevent.the.accidents.or.incidents.from.occur-ring..If.the.hazards.are.known,.it.is.easier.to.develop.interventions.that.mitigate.the.
risk.potential..These.interventions.may.be.in.the.form.of.safe.operating.procedures..
Training.workers.to.identify.potential.or.real.hazards.as.quickly.as.possible.defi-nitely.will.reduce.the.number.of.accidents/incidents.that.could.occur..Once.hazards.
are.identified,.the.company.must.have.a.system.of.reporting.these.hazards.that.is.
accompanied.by.real-time.response.by.supervision.and.management.
WorksIte hAzArd IdentIFIcAtIon
Employers.must.identify.the.workplace.hazards.before.they.can.determine.how.to.
protect. their. employees.. In. performing. worksite. hazard. identification,. employers.
must.consider.not.only.hazards.that.currently.exist.in.the.workplace,.but.also.those.
hazards.that.could.occur.because.of.changes.in.operations.or.procedures,.or.because.
of.other.factors.such.as.concurrent.work.activities..For.this.element,.employers.should . 1..Perform.hazard.identification.of.all.worksites.prior.to.the.start.of.work.
. 2..Perform.regular.safety.and.health.inspections.
. 3..Require.supervisors.and.employees.to.inspect.their.workspace.prior.to.the.
start.of.each.work.shift.or.new.activity.
. 4..Investigate.accidents.and.near-misses.
. 5..Analyze.trends.in.accident.and.injury.data.
So.that.all.hazards.are.identified,.conduct.comprehensive.baseline.worksite.sur-veys.for.safety.and.health,.and.perform.periodic.comprehensive. updated.surveys..
Analyze.planned.and.new.facilities,.processes,.materials,.and.equipment..Perform.
routine.job.hazard.analyses.
Provide.for.regular.site.safety.and.health.inspections.to.identify.new.or.previ-ously.missed.hazards.and.failures.in.hazard.controls..So.that.employee.insight.and.
experience.in.safety.and.health.protection.can.be.utilized.and.employee.concerns.
can. be. addressed,. provide. a. reliable. system. wherein. employees,. without. fear. of.
reprisal,.can.notify.management.personnel.about.conditions.that.appear.hazardous.
and.receive.timely.and.appropriate.responses;.and.encourage.employees.to.use.the.
